Choosing the right platform can make or break your freelance career. Here are the five best options for Pakistani freelancers in 2025, with honest pros and cons.
1. Fiverr
Fiverr remains the easiest platform to start on. You create service listings ("gigs") and clients find you. The 20% fee is steep but the platform provides massive exposure. Calculate your earnings with our Fiverr Fee Calculator.
Best for: Beginners, creative services, repetitive deliverables.
2. Upwork
Upwork is ideal for longer-term projects and higher budgets. The sliding fee scale rewards loyalty. Use our Upwork Fee Calculator to understand costs.
Best for: Developers, consultants, writers seeking ongoing work.
3. Freelancer.com
A contest-based and bid-based platform. Competitions can be a good way to build your portfolio, though the pay-per-bid model can be frustrating.
Best for: Designers (contests), developers willing to bid competitively.
4. PeoplePerHour
UK-focused platform that attracts European clients. Can be less competitive than Fiverr or Upwork for certain niches. Good rates for specialized skills.
Best for: SEO specialists, virtual assistants, marketing professionals.
5. Toptal
Elite platform with a rigorous screening process. Only accepts top 3% of applicants. If accepted, you get access to premium clients and premium rates.
Best for: Senior developers, designers, and finance experts with strong portfolios.
